Mikey Learns to Ride is a heartwarming, rhythmic picture book that captures a universal milestone in every child's life: the exhilarating and sometimes daunting experience of learning to ride a bicycle without training wheels. The story follows young Mikey, who has been eagerly waiting since Christmas to take his shiny new bike outside. After a spring day finally arrives, Mikey faces the challenges of safety gear, the initial wobble of balance, and the inevitable "crash" that tests his resolve. Through the gentle, encouraging support of his father, Mikey discovers the pride of perseverance, ultimately mastering his bike and finding the confidence to ride all on his own.

A native of Columbus, Ohio, Scott Reeves brings a lifetime of experience and a passion for storytelling to his writing. A dedicated family man and educator for over 30 years, Reeves channels his background as a former athlete, teacher, and coach into crafting narratives that aim to inspire, educate, and entertain. His literary portfolio is diverse, spanning from the creation of fun-loving characters in children's books to compelling short stories. Beyond fiction, Reeves possesses a deep-seated passion for historical research, focusing specifically on backstories of significant historical events and family interest. Now, on the verge of completing a distinguished career in education, Reeves is embracing this new chapter, dedicating his time and energy to his enduring love for writing.
